  • Iron overload in the heart: a hidden risk for transfusion patients?

    Knowledge-focused Completed

    This study looked at how common iron buildup in the heart is among people with thalassemia, sickle cell disease, or myelodysplasia who receive many blood transfusions. Researchers used MRI scans to measure iron levels in the heart and liver of 110 participants. The goal was to be…
